One of the most significant trends in cloud security is the adoption of Zero Trust Architecture (ZTA). Unlike traditional security models that operate on the assumption that everything inside an organization's network is safe, ZTA operates on the principle of 'never trust, always verify.' This approach requires strict identity verification for every user and device attempting to access resources, ensuring that even internal threats are mitigated. As enterprises continue to migrate to the cloud, integrating ZTA into their security protocols will become essential for safeguarding sensitive data.
Data breaches have become alarmingly common, prompting organizations to bolster their encryption methods. Advanced encryption techniques, such as homomorphic encryption and format-preserving encryption, are gaining traction. These methods allow data to be processed in an encrypted state, significantly reducing the risk of exposure during transit or storage. Enterprises are increasingly recognizing the importance of implementing these advanced encryption strategies to protect their data assets in the cloud.
The integ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) into cloud security solutions is revolutionizing the way threats are detected and mitigated. AI-driven tools can analyze vast amounts of data in real-time, identifying unusual patterns or behaviors that may indicate a security breach. By leveraging these technologies, enterprises can respond more quickly to threats, minimizing potential damage and ensuring a more robust security posture.
As data privacy concerns rise globally, regulatory bodies are implementing stricter compliance requirements. Enterprises must now navigate a complex landscape of regulations such as GDPR, CCPA, and HIPAA. Cloud service providers are also enhancing their offerings to ensure compliance, providing tools and resources that help organizations meet their legal obligations. Embracing compliance not only protects businesses from legal repercussions but also builds trust with customers who are increasingly aware of their data rights.
Manual security processes can lead to delays and human error, making organizations vulnerable to cyber threats. As a result, security automation is becoming a top priority for enterprises. Automated solutions can streamline security operations, from threat detection to incident response, allowing IT teams to focus on strategic initiatives. By implementing security automation tools, organizations can enhance their agility and responsiveness to emerging threats, significantly reducing the time to detect and address vulnerabilities.
With the rise of interconnected services, supply chain security has emerged as a crucial consideration for cloud-dependent enterprises. Cyber attackers often target third-party vendors to gain access to larger networks. Organizations are now prioritizing vendor risk assessments and implementing stricter security measures for third-party applications. Developing a comprehensive supply chain security strategy will be essential for safeguarding enterprise data in a digital ecosystem.
